Default Behringer DDX3216 Control Surface

Hi All,

I had an ancient DDX3216 console that was of not much use as an audio device but I thought it would be nice to try if I could get it to work as a control surface for Reaper.

This is the result of a few nights work. It's not pretty but it works

I used Bome's Midi Translator to get from SysEx to MIDI Controllers and notes only.
DDX3216 to Reaper was done using a keymap.
Reaper to DDX3216 was done using 4 HUI control surfaces.

For more details see the readme file inside the attached zip file.

This also contains the Reaper Keymap file and the Bome's translator project.

I'm interested to know if anybody is actually still looking for this solution.
